Episode 17 — How To Navigate Power Outages As A Virtual Assistant
They say “keep calm and carry on”… but what about when the Wi-Fi is down, the lights are out, and your laptop battery is fighting for its life? 😅⚡️ In this episode, River Lee and fellow VA Tiffany Higgins get real about power outages (and all the chaos that comes with them) — and how to stay professional, calm, and confident when things are totally out of your control. ✨ What we cover: 🔋 What to prep before the storm hits (laptop, chargers, power bank, etc.) 📶 What to do when power is on… but the internet is trash 🗂️ Pro tip: schedule what you can ahead of time (future you will THANK you) 💬 How to communicate with your supervisor without panic-apologizing 🧠 “Triage mode” — how to prioritize once everything comes back online 🕯️ Tiffany’s “Calm Plan” for staying grounded when stress spikes 🏃♀️ Backup options: Starbucks, hotel lobbies, co-working spaces, even your car charger 💡 Big takeaway: It’s not about avoiding chaos — it’s about staying calm in the thick of it. And every time it happens, you build more confidence for next time.
